1. Training Facilities and Coaches
Training Facilities
To ensure your players develop to their full potential, world-class training facilities are essential.
If your club hasn’t maxed out its training facilities yet, go to the board request section and ask for "improve training facilities".
Coaches
Employing a set of gold coaches with natural aptitude is crucial. You also couldn't go wrong with coaches with a higher reputation.
For normal teams, "Youth, Fitness, Fitness, Fitness, Attacking" is a good combination.
But if your aim is to build a galactico with best players in every position - my preference is to maintain a balanced portfolio of "Youth, Attacking, Defending, Fitness, and Goalkeeping" coaches.
2. Regen System
The regen system is my absolute favourite feature of FMM. Legendary players like Messi and Ronaldo will have regens with the same potential ability as they did in their prime.
Once you master regen tracking, it is really simple to create your own version of superteam!
Tracking Regens
Try to create a shortlist of legendary players and monitor their retirement date.
Regens usually appear on July 1st after a player retires on June 30th (but may also pop up randomly between July and August).
Regens share the same (1) nationality, (2) natural position, (3) weak foot combinations, (4) penalty ability and (5) free kick ability, making them easier to spot.
Good regen = Young regens (ages 15-16) and high total attributes (TA ~200).

3. Training and Matches
Understanding player development is key. Monitor the “development center” page where players gain experience through matches.
Players get upgraded attributes when their progress bar fills. Good match performance fills the progress bar more quickly.
Higher average match ratings also tends to contribute to better attribute growth.
Role-Specific Training
Players can be trained in various roles to enhance specific attributes.
Don't be afraid to train players in different positions and tactical roles along their growth journey.
Let's say you want to develop an all-round midfielder. You can develop him in Central Midfielder role for defensive attributes, then Winger/Central Forward role for attacking attributes.

4. Mentoring and Personality
Young players can benefit significantly from mentorship, gaining both attribute increases and desirable personalities.
Choosing Mentors
Each player can undergo two rounds of mentoring.
Positive traits can be transferred from the mentor to the player upon the completion of the mentorship.
Select good mentors with nice personalities for your young players, like Kane for attackers and Kimmich for defenders.
Desired Personalities
I always want my players to obtain the “Hardworking” personality as it is the only trait that give you bonus attribute increase (teamwork). My personal second favourite is the “Professional” personality.
"Determined", "Consistent" and "Capable under pressure" are nice personalities as well.
5. Position Retrain
Retraining players in different positions not only enhances their versatility but also grants additional attribute increases.
Position-Specific Improvements
From my experience, each new position can provide a maximum of a +2 attribute boost. For instance:
A CF retrain may improve shooting and creativity attributes.
A WF retrain may improve crossing and dribbling attributes.
A CB retrain may improve positioning and tackling attributes.
Train your young players in multiple positions while they are still open to it, as they may refuse position retraining as they age.
You can start with training players in positions where they have at least "reasonable" aptitude, but in fact "poor" aptitude would work fine too.
